Block

#18,582,863
Block Number
18,582,863 @ 05/22/2024, 05:41:10
Status
Finalized
ID
0x011b8d4f99ea588fe65e0daed9091f1a487d24e5f79e5f0fa003033b754dfc90
Transactions
Gas Used
36518/39960938 (0.09% Used)
Total Score
1,811,054,914 (+96)
Rewards
0.11 VTHO